Transaction 43a7fb48b80c016574c2e09ab13f961b25ff55c8146973e3e0d3e5f30cfb6631
1 Input
2 Outputs
- 43a7fb48b80c016574c2e09ab13f961b25ff55c8146973e3e0d3e5f30cfb6631:0
- 43a7fb48b80c016574c2e09ab13f961b25ff55c8146973e3e0d3e5f30cfb6631:1
value 13958750
address 18rEQaUtQ2fJ6C3EgPkngN4LgvkVsoYm5P
value 76035148
address 1LU3DE2veYee1UEeaZJMpZNbg1ioRH7o5T